## December 2024
33+
34+
- If you're using Microsoft's unified security operations (SecOps) platform, with both Microsoft Sentinel and Microsoft Defender XDR, Microsoft Sentinel workbooks are now available to view directly in the Microsoft Defender portal. Continue tabbing out to the Azure portal only to edit your workbooks. For more information, see [Visualize and monitor your data by using workbooks in Microsoft Sentinel](/azure/sentinel/monitor-your-data?tabs=azure-portal).
3335
- (Preview) The [Link to incident](advanced-hunting-defender-results.md#link-query-results-to-an-incident) feature in Microsoft Defender advanced hunting now allows linking of Microsoft Sentinel query results. In both the Microsoft Defender unified experience and in [Defender XDR advanced hunting](advanced-hunting-link-to-incident.md), you can now specify whether an entity is an impacted asset or related evidence.
3436
- (Preview) In [advanced hunting](advanced-hunting-defender-use-custom-rules.md#use-adx-operator-for-azure-data-explorer-queries-preview), Microsoft Defender portal users can now use the `adx()` operator to query tables stored in Azure Data Explorer. You no longer need to go to log analytics in Microsoft Sentinel to use this operator if you are already in Microsoft Defender.
3537
- New documentation library for Microsoft's unified security operations platform. Find centralized documentation about [Microsoft's unified SecOps platform in the Microsoft Defender portal](/unified-secops-platform/overview-unified-security). Microsoft's unified SecOps platform brings together the full capabilities of Microsoft Sentinel, Microsoft Defender XDR, Microsoft Security Exposure Management, and generative AI into the Defender portal. Learn about the features and functionality available with Microsoft's unified SecOps platform, then start to plan your deployment.

- (Preview) The [CloudProcessEvents](advanced-hunting-cloudprocessevents-table.md) table is now available for preview in advanced hunting. It contains information about process events in multicloud hosted environments. You can use it to discover threats that can be observed through process details, like malicious processes or command-line signatures.
4648
- (Preview) Migrating custom detection queries to **Continuous (near real-time or NRT) frequency** is now available for preview in advanced hunting. Using the Continuous (NRT) frequency increases your organization's ability to identify threats faster. It has minimal to no impact to your resource usage, and should thus be considered for any qualified custom detection rule in your organization. You can migrate compatible KQL queries by following the steps in [Continuous (NRT) frequency](custom-detection-rules.md#continuous-nrt-frequency).
